FAQ
What is the primary purpose of this DEF 14A filing for Exponent Inc.?
The primary purpose is to disclose information regarding the solicitation of proxies for the company's annual meeting of stockholders, including details on executive compensation, director nominations, and other corporate governance matters.
What fiscal year does the compensation information in this filing pertain to?
The compensation information pertains to the fiscal year ending January 3, 2025.
What types of stock awards are detailed in the filing?
The filing details the year-end fair value of outstanding and unvested stock awards granted during the year and in prior years, as well as changes in fair value for stock awards that vest during the year.
What is the company's former name and when was the name change?
The company's former name was FAILURE GROUP INC, and the date of the name change was August 31, 1993.
What is Exponent Inc.'s Standard Industrial Classification (SIC) code and description?
Exponent Inc.'s SIC code is 8742, which corresponds to Services-Management Consulting Services.
